What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R  1926.501(b)(10):Each employee engaged in roofing activities on low-slope roofs with unprotected sides and edges 6 feet or more above lower levels and 50-feet (15.25 m) wide or less, was not protected from falling by guardrail systems, safety nets:  a.) At the jobsite, located at 10260 Bloomingdale Ave Riverview, FL 33578; On or about 2/27/24, the employer exposed employee to fall hazards, in that, a fall protection system was provided or utilized while working approximately  14 ft and 18 ft on the roof of a commercial building roof tops conducting TPO installation operations.

29 CFR  1926.503(b)(1):The employer did not verify compliance with paragraph (a) of this section by preparing a written (training) certification record including the name or other identity of the employee trained, the date(s) of the training, and the signature of the person who conducted the training or the signature of the employer.  a.) At the jobsite, located at 10260 Bloomingdale Ave Riverview, FL 33578; On or about 2/27/24, the employer exposed employee to fall hazards, in that, fall protection certification training records were not provided for employees working approximately 14 ft and 18 ft on the roof of a commercial building roof tops conducting TPO installation operations.
